Description

The following form authorizes a photographer to make photographs of a subject and use the photographs as still photographs, transparencies, motion pictures, television, video or other similar media.

A simple consent form should begin with a statement granting permission for specific actions, like sharing photos online. Clearly outline the rights and responsibilities of each party involved, as well as the time frame for consent. You can rely on a New Jersey Photo Release Form for Social Media to streamline this process and ensure clarity in your agreements.

When crafting a media release consent form, specify the type of media being used, like photographs or videos, and the intended platform, such as social media. Mention any restrictions or conditions for usage. A photo release statement allows the holder to specify the terms under which they can use an image. An example could be, 'I allow Your Company to use my image on all social media platforms without any compensation.'
